html, body         { background-image: none; text-align: center; margin: 10px auto 0; border: 0 }body         { color: #000; font-size: 80%; font-family: "Gill CE", "Verdana CE", "Arial CE", "Helvetica CE", sans-serif; background-position: center; text-align: center; margin: 10px auto 0; width: 100% }/*main classes*/.container                        { background-image: url(images/underban.jpg); background-repeat: no-repeat; background-position: center top; text-align: center; margin: 0 auto; width: 100%; height: auto }.top                       { background-image: url(images/banner.jpg); background-repeat: no-repeat; background-position: center top; margin: 0 auto 0; width: 800px; height: 198px }.middle   { background-repeat: no-repeat; background-position: center top; margin: 0 auto; width: 800px; height: auto }.bottom        { background-position: right bottom; margin-right: auto; margin-left: auto; width: 800px; height: 30px; clear: both; border-top: 1pt dashed gray }.blank     { background-position: right bottom; margin-right: auto; margin-left: auto; width: 800px; height: 30px; clear: both }/*middle classes*/.leftholder                   { text-align: left; width: 400px; height: auto; float: left }.rightholder                       { background-position: right bottom; width: 400px; height: auto; float: right }/*top classes*/.bannerright { background-position: right bottom; margin-left: 28px; width: 150px; height: 198px; float: right }.bannerblank       { text-align: left; width: 600px; height: 165px; float: left }.menuholder   { text-align: left; width: 500px; height: 20px; float: left }.menu        { text-align: left; width: 450px; height: 20px; float: left; clear: both; border-bottom: 2pt solid orange }.submenumenu   { text-align: left; width: 370px; height: 20px; float: left; clear: left }.menu p    { color: gray; font-size: 11px; margin: 3px 0 0 }.menu a:link { color: gray; font-size: 11px;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.menu a:active { color: orange;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.menu a:visited { color: gray;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.menu a:hover { color: silver; font-size: 11px;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.submenu p     { color: gray; font-size: 10px; margin: 3px 0 0 }.submenu a:link  { color: gray; font-size: 10px;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.submenu a:active { color: orange;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.submenu a:visited { color: gray;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}.submenu a:hover  { color: silver; font-size: 10px; font-weight: normal; text-decoration: none; background-image: none; background-position: 370px 150px }/*content classes*/.leftH       { background-image: none; width: 400px; height: 35px; float: left }.rightH         { background-image: none; width: 400px; height: 35px; float: right }.img   { background-image: none; margin-top: 35px; margin-left: auto; width: 400px; height: auto; float: right }
.img2   { background-image: none; margin-top: 15px; margin-left: 5px; width: 400px; height: auto; float: left }
h2   { color: orange; font-size: 12pt; background-image: none; text-align: left; text-indent: 25px; padding: 10px; border-left: 5px solid orange}h3    { color: black; font-size: 10pt; font-weight: normal; background-image: none; text-align: left; text-indent: 25px; margin-bottom: 0; padding: 10px 10px 0 15px; width: 370px }.left         { background-image: none; margin-top: 15px; top: 0; width: 370px; height: auto; float: left }.left p     { color: #5a5a5a; font-size: 10pt; font-weight: lighter; line-height: 14pt; background-image: none; text-align: justify; text-indent: 30px; padding-bottom: 0; padding-left: 10px; width: 370px; float: left }
.left ol    { color: #5a5a5a; font-size: 10pt; font-weight: lighter; line-height: 14pt; background-image: none; text-align: justify; padding-bottom: 0; padding-left: 30px; margin-right: 10px; width: 360px; float: left }
.left li	{ margin-bottom: 10px; }.left a:link { color: #5a5a5a }.left a:visited { color: #5a5a5a }.left a:hover { color: black }.ph { color: black; font-size: 10pt; font-weight: bold; line-height: 14pt; background-image: none; text-align: justify; text-indent: 30px; padding-top: 30px; padding-left: 10px; width: 370px; float: left }.stopka           { background-image: none; text-align: right; width: 800px; height: auto; clear: both }.stopka p       { color: gray; font-size: 8pt; font-weight: normal; line-height: 12pt; background-image: none; clear: both }.stopka a:link   { color: gray; font-weight: normal; background-image: none; clear: both }.stopka a:hover   { color: silver; font-weight: normal; text-decoration: none; background-image: none; clear: both }.stopka a:visited { color: gray; font-weight: normal; text-decoration: none; background-image: none; clear: both }/*price list*/.leftprice   { background-image: none; margin-top: 15px; width: 370px; height: auto; float: left }.leftprice p { color: #5a5a5a; font-size: 10pt; font-weight: lighter; line-height: 14pt; background-image: none; text-align: justify; text-indent: 30px; padding-bottom: 0; padding-left: 10px; float: left }.plleft         { margin-top: 15px; margin-bottom: 0; margin-left: 0; width: 220px; float: left }.plright      { font-size: 11px; text-align: right; margin: 15px 5px 0 0; width: 140px; float: right }.plleft p  { font-size: 11px; line-height: 10pt; text-align: left; text-indent: 0; margin-top: 0; margin-bottom: 0; margin-left: 0 }.plright p    { font-size: 11px; line-height: 10pt; text-align: right; margin: 0 0 0 0; padding-right: 10px; width: 150px }.adres { margin-right: 30px }.adres p { color: gray; font-size: 11px; text-align: right }